Audience challenged to solve 'outrageous' murder mystery
Lichfield arts and entertainment venue The Hub at St Mary’s is preparing to host an “outrageous murder mystery” next month.
Locomotive for Murder. The Improvised Whodunnit – is coming to the venue on 22 February at 7.30pm.
Pinch Punch welcome you aboard Locomotive for Murder: The Improvised Whodunnit, a murder mystery where killing the cast and cracking the case is in your hands.
Expect dubious accents and shaky alibis, along with thrills, spills and good old-fashioned kills.
Four characters board a train, but not everyone will survive. Thankfully, a world-famous detective is onboard, ready to solve the case.
But who is the murderer? Only one person in the show knows – the murderer themself! It’s down to the audience to help the detective solve the case.
Using audience stories and suggestions, watch Pinch Punch create a one-of-a-kind, never-to-be-repeated whodunnit.
The Reviews Hub describes the show as: “A first class improvised murder mystery with hilarious performances.”
